A teacher has 12.5 M NaOH solution. How many milliliters of concentrated NaOH are needed to make 635mL of 0.625M NaOH?​

Answer:

31.75mL

Explanation:

C₁V₁=C₂V₂

V₁=C₂V₂/C₁=

=0.625×635/12.5=

=31.75mL
